The Seton Hall Pirates lost again on Monday night, 80-54, to the Villanova Wildcats. The team is in a major funk right now, having dropped eight of their last 10 games.
And the frustration really boiled over late in the second half of Monday’s game, when members of both teams were battling for a loose ball. That’s when Pirates guard Sterling Gibbs used his forearm and delivered a cheap shot to the face of Villanova’s Ryan Arcidiacono.
Gibbs was ejected, and he could be hit with a multiple-game suspension for the blow to Arcidiacono’s face. He did apologize to Arcidiacono on Twitter after the game, though.
